was an ambitious digital experiment launched by Anheuser-Busch in early 2007, just after the Super Bowl, designed to bypass traditional media and connect directly with young adult consumers through a proprietary online television network. Despite significant financial backing and high-profile partnerships with creators like Kevin Spacey and Matt Damon, the platform ultimately "landed with a thud" and was shut down by 2009. In the modern digital landscape, the phrase "Web BudTV work" has taken on an entirely different meaning. Third-party developers and stream providers have adopted variations of the name—such as or BUD TV Ultra Gold —to market independent Internet Protocol Television (IPTV) applications.
